Dear SFB Families,

We are adopting the guideline of quarantining for five days upon a positive COVID result. After five days if students are fever-free for 24 hours without the use of fever-reducing medications and have symptom improvement, students may return to school, mask optional. We recommend, but do not require, you and your family to refer to the local health department to make your own further quarantine decisions accordingly.
An updated version of our plan will be available in the near future. Meetings and discussions have taken place and again are scheduled for next week regarding details of the plan.
In short:
  • School goal of remaining open and face-to-face
  • Masks optional
  • 5-day quarantine
  • Text announcements to specific grades only
